Transaction 63990445fbd11e6a733a94c9076609aab04f9a836b70c25afd7a050ccb52afb1

1 Input
2 Outputs
  • 63990445fbd11e6a733a94c9076609aab04f9a836b70c25afd7a050ccb52afb1:0
  • value  427606
    address  115PRMwSEyT7R5d995kPUp9ALvnYiAGoXx
  • 63990445fbd11e6a733a94c9076609aab04f9a836b70c25afd7a050ccb52afb1:1
  • value  3601300
    address  16wfxrXinAtPDpfPPxwoXw6UVtLuSbV7Dp